Today, Château Beaucastel is one of the most established estates in Châteauneuf-du-Pape. Carrying on the tradition of blending the 13 historic grape varieties of Châteauneuf-du-PapeHe creates a unique style every year. This is what gives the wines their exceptional combination of power, structure, elegance and freshness.

A rich history

The first traces of Château de Beaucastel as it exists today date back to the 15th century. In 1549, Pierre de Beaucastel bought “a barn with its tenement of land”. The mansion was later built here, with the Beaucastel coat of arms carved into the stone, in a small salon with a French-style ceiling.

Much later, in 1909, Pierre Tramier took over the estate. He then passed it on to his son-in-law, Pierre Perrin, a man of science who helped Beaucastel take off. Jacques Perrin continued his father’s efforts until 1978, giving this wine its letters of nobility.

Today, the torch is in the hands of Jean-Pierre and François, Jacques Perrin’s sons, who are continuing the Château de Beaucastel story.

Beaucastel is first and foremost a family affair, the Perrin family, whose strength lies in its ability to bring together the talents of each to bring their vineyards to life under the aegis of shared values. These include absolute respect for the land and terroir, biodynamic viticulture as a philosophy of life, and the quest for truth, balance and elegance.

The Perrin family vintages

Château Beaucastel

The Perrin family produces numerous cuvées, the most prestigious of which is the
Châteauneuf-du-Pape Beaucastel red.
Acclaimed by critics such as Jancis Robinson, James Suckling and Bettane & Desseauve, this “fat, chocolatey, powerful and voluminous wine” possesses “freshness and density”. The palate is full and supple. Figs, cherries, blackberries, stewed fruits… are supported by a fine acidity. The tannins are fine and wonderfully pleasant to taste.

Coudoulet Castle

The Perrin family also offers more affordable vintages under the Château de Coudoulet umbrella, with reds and whites. However, these wines do not have the prestigious Châteauneuf-du-Pape appellation, but rather the Côtes-du-rhône appellation. A way to discover the Perrin family without breaking the bank!
